Product Description

The Kitables Solar Charger Kit gives you everything you need to build your own functioning solar charger. It's compatible with most smartphones and tablets, including iPhone, iPad, and Android devices. Battery Charge Time Solar: ~14 hours Battery Charge Time Wall: ~2 hours Phone Charge Time: ~2-3 hours* Build Dimensions: ~ 4. 5 x2. 5 x7/8 Weight: 116g (equivalent to 46 pennies) *Charge times vary between devices, operating systems, and other factors.

Customers say

Customers like the quality of the solar panel, mentioning it's a wonderful project and perfect for a science fair project. However, some customers report issues with performance and ease of use. They mention that the required tools are not intuitive and the directions are confusing. Additionally, some complain that the product is difficult to set up and requires a soldering gun.
